Core Purpose:
The Finance & Administration Manager\xe2\x80\x99s role enhances and improves the financial operations and governance of the school environment. This position is responsible for the accounting, financial reporting and financial operations of the school, including the production of monthly financial reports, maintenance of an adequate system of accounting records, a comprehensive set of controls to mitigate risk, enhance the accuracy of the schools reported financial results, and ensure that reported results comply with international financial reporting standards.

Main Responsibilities:

Core Finance
  • Oversee the operations of the Accounting Department, including the design of an organisational structure adequate for achieving the department\'s goals and objectives
  • Update and enhance the financial policies and procedures of the school and maintain a documented system of policies and procedures
  • Design internal control systems for all departments to ensure the safeguarding of school assets and monitor and enforce internal controls
  • Ensure the efficient operation and integration of the accounting system throughout the school
  • Ensure the timely reporting of all monthly and annual financial information
  • Ensure general ledger and financial statements are complete and accurate
  • Perform general ledger reconciliations including deferred income and other account analysis
  • Each month end, update a \xe2\x80\x98month end\xe2\x80\x99 folder with detailed balance sheet reconciliations for all balance sheet items
  • Daily cash reporting and monthly bank reconciliations
  • Manage the production of the annual budget and forecasts
  • Liaise with banks, audit, legal and tax providers as necessary
  • Comply with government reporting requirements and tax filings
  • KPI and performance monitoring
  • Maintain the fixed asset register by supervising the recording of all items in the inventory, maintaining pertinent records and ensuring adequate treatment of fixed asset acquisitions and disposals
  • Manage payables, receivables and invoicing functions of the school efficiency
  • Monitor debt levels and compliance with debt covenants
  • Prepare monthly budget variance reports and work with the Headmaster on corrective actions
  • Provide financial analysis for decision support including capital investments, pricing decisions, and contract negotiations
  • Assist the group with gathering data and preparing reports for key personnel as requested
  • Ensure the school has the adequate insurance cover at all times
  • Liaise with suppliers and clients when needed to ensure the smooth running of the day to day operations
  • Reviewing of operational contracts to ensure \xe2\x80\x9cbest value\xe2\x80\x9d is achieved
  • Provide financial analysis for decision support including capital investments, pricing decisions, and contract negotiations
  • Assist the group with gathering data and preparing reports for key personnel as requested
  • Prepare and submit payroll to the bank
  • Supervise the Accounts Department, which includes enhancing the department development and setting the departmental objectives
  • Enforcing the group authorisation limits table
  • Ad hoc duties as required

The International Schools Partnership
Aspen Heights British School is part of The International Schools Partnership (ISP).
The International Schools Partnership (ISP) is a growing group of committed colleagues in financially responsible schools around the world, all of which aim to be the school of choice in their local area. Learning is at the heart of everything we do for our pupils, colleagues and parents. We are committed to getting better, all the time.
ISP was founded by an experienced team of committed educationalists and commercial operators who have worked together over many years. Our growing group of private schools located in the UK, the USA, Europe, Costa Rica, Chile, Colombia, Ecuador, the United Arab Emirates, Qatar, Malaysia, Mexico and Peru educate children and pupils from 2-18 years of age. We have now expanded to 45 schools delivering multiple curricula and building on local brands and reputations with around 45,000 pupils and 7,000 staff located across the globe.
